I made some more progress on the wiki.  For one thing, I added a 
node called IncompleteDocumentation (linked from the main page) 
which will list all the pages that currently say "Not 
documented".... so anyone who figures out how to use a method or 
property that's not documented can now put a description in for 
the rest of us, and it'll be included in the Gambas help browser 
soonish :)

The reason I did that is because I wrote a program that finds 
exported documentation from the info files that has no page 
including it, and creates a "Not documented" page for that node.  
As a result, while there are only about 30 undocumented pages on 
the main wiki, there are about 440 on the test wiki. :)

I also started making export files for the component pages, and 
even figured out how to insert child classes under their parents 
(I think.... basically, any class that's used as a type in a 
symbol of one and only one other class, I consider a child of 
that class, and it seems to match up with what is already out 
there and what Benoit has been saying.)  I haven't replaced the 
existing component pages with them yet except for the Qt one 
though, and again only in the test wiki.
